About the match

    Anderlecht faces Cercle Brugge at Lotto Park on Sun, Mar 22, 2026, 17:30 UTC. This match is part of the Belgian Pro League.   • The lineups are:
    Anderlecht (4-2-3-1): Colin Coosemans - Killian Sardella, Mihajlo Ilic, Moussa Diarra, Ludwig Augustinsson - Anas Tajaouart, Mario Stroeykens - Tristan Degreef, Nathan De Cat, Mihajlo Cvetkovic - Thorgan Hazard.
    Cercle Brugge (4-4-2): Warleson - Gary Magnée, Emmanuel Kakou, Geoffrey Kondo, Flávio Nazinho - Valy Konaté, Pieter Gerkens, Hannes van der Bruggen, Edan Diop - Dante Vanzeir, Oumar Diakité.
